Over 250 people killed on OPP patrolled roads so far this year
The OPP is reminding residents to be safe on the roads and in the water.
Sgt Kerry Schmidt says the statistics so far this year are staggering.
"257 people have died already this year in collisions on our roads, on our trails, in off-road vehicles or out on the water."
Nine of the deaths have occurred within the last seven days.
He adds speeding, impaired driving and failing to yield are the most common causes of collisions.
So far this year, over 10,000 charges have been laid for impaired driving or stunt driving.
